I am still a wee beginner with sewing. I got incredibly lucky and was given a bunch from a friend that are exactly like these that they never used, but they are of higher quality from a mix of other brands.I would prefer to take really good care of them until I’m more comfortable with my craft because some aren’t exactly cheap (for example: one Brother presser foot is the same price as this whole kit lol)Found these online and figured they would work wonderfully while I learn. They have!If you’re new to sewing like myself and you want to see firsthand how each presser foot works without having to spend a lot of money at once, this may be just the thing for you. There’s a good variety in this kit that should cover all the basics.As mentioned prior, understand that these are not high quality. You can tell as soon as you pick one up that they are cheaply made. They’re light and don’t have that “sturdy” feel to them like a good quality presser foot will have, so be sure you keep that in mind if you plan to get this set.For me, that’s all okay.So far, they have done fairly well when on my machine. The accuracy is alright and I have to sometimes position my needle to be just right for certain ones, but all the pieces that were supposed to be there was. Nothing was broken, they all arrived safely, and they went on without issue and stayed on until I manually removed them.They’ve gotten the job done thus far on my practice projects, so I can see these as being great backups to have on hand in the future in case of anything. So, if you’re looking for extras to have on hand for that very purpose, you can’t go wrong for the price.To add: if quality is what you’re after while looking for a price deal, check MadamSew. A couple that were given to me came from that brand, and they’re pretty nice.Happy sewing, everyone!

Great little tool, but may need some adapting itself
I bought this adapter so I could use a set of presser feet I bought (also from Amazon). The adapter seems well made and quite solid, but it initially didn't fit the snap feet because it was just a bit too wide. Looking closer, the chrome plating was a bit too thick right at the spot where the adapter was supposed to click onto the presser feet.However, I put the adapter into my workbench vice and used one of the sanding pads on my multi-tool to sand it down a wee bit. That worked like a charm - took off just enough for the foot to fit snugly but perfectly into the presser feet.The adapter has been working perfectly and the very snug, customized fit turns out to be an advantage, as it holds the presser feet securely so they don't wobble or slip around when in use.

Updating vintage machines
Have several vintage machines that I need to adapt for the modern presser feet. Have three machines that had screw on presser feet, which has a limited selection. These adaptors fit my 1970 Singer, 1950 Singer and 1998 Kenmore. It seems to be made of a rather flimsy "metal" so I don't know how long they will last. If you can find it in stainless steel-buy it.
